============= Biomart 0.9.2

Python API that consumes the biomart webservice.

What it will do:

  • Show all databases of a biomart server
  • Show all datasets of a biomart database
  • Show attributes and filters of a biomart dataset
  • Run your query formatted as a Python dict and return the Biomart response as TSV format.

What it won't do:

  • Process and return the results as JSON,XML,etc.

Usage

Import Biomart module ::

from biomart import BiomartServer

Connect to a Biomart Server ::

server = BiomartServer( "http://www.biomart.org/biomart" )

if you are behind a proxy

import os server.http_proxy = os.environ.get('http_proxy', 'http://my_http_proxy.org')

set verbose to True to get some messages

server.verbose = True

Interact with the biomart server ::

show server databases

server.show_databases() # uses pprint behind the scenes

show server datasets

server.show_datasets() # uses pprint behind the scenes

use the 'uniprot' dataset

uniprot = server.datasets['uniprot']

show all available filters and attributes of the 'uniprot' dataset

uniprot.show_filters() # uses pprint uniprot.show_attributes() # uses pprint

Run a search ::

run a search with the default attributes - equivalent to hitting "Results" on the web interface.

this will return a lot of data.

response = uniprot.search() response = uniprot.search( header = 1 ) # if you need the columns header

response format is TSV

for line in response.iter_lines(): line = line.decode('utf-8') print(line.split("\t"))

run a count - equivalent to hitting "Count" on the web interface

response = uniprot.count() print(response.text)

run a search with custom filters and default attributes.

response = uniprot.search({ 'filters': { 'accession': 'Q9FMA1' } }, header = 1 )

response = uniprot.search({ 'filters': { 'accession': ['Q9FMA1', 'Q8LFJ9'] # ID-list specified accessions } }, header = 1 )

run a search with custom filters and attributes (no header)

response = uniprot.search({ 'filters': { 'accession': ['Q9FMA1', 'Q8LFJ9'] }, 'attributes': [ 'accession', 'protein_name' ] })

Shortcut function: connect directly to a biomart dataset This is short in code but it might be long in time since the module needs to fetch all server's databases to find your dataset. ::

from biomart import BiomartDataset

interpro = BiomartDataset( "http://www.biomart.org/biomart", name = 'entry' )

response = interpro.search({ 'filters': { 'entry_id': 'IPR027603' }, 'attributes': [ 'entry_name', 'abstract' ] })
